Subject: [PATCH 3/3] spi: tegra210-quad: add rate limiting and simplify timeout error message

On malfunctioning hardware, timeout error messages can appear thousands
of times, creating unnecessary system pressure and log bloat. This patch
makes two improvements:

1. Replace dev_err() with dev_err_ratelimited() to prevent log flooding
   when hardware errors persist
2. Remove the redundant timeout value parameter from the error message,
   as 'ret' is always zero in this error path

These changes reduce logging overhead while maintaining necessary error
reporting for debugging purposes.

Signed-off-by: Breno Leitao <leitao@debian.org>
---
 drivers/spi/spi-tegra210-quad.c |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/spi/spi-tegra210-quad.c b/drivers/spi/spi-tegra210-quad.c
index 7c10b1272b0ad..e8dd1c061a49b 100644
--- a/drivers/spi/spi-tegra210-quad.c
+++ b/drivers/spi/spi-tegra210-quad.c
@@ -1118,8 +1118,8 @@ static int tegra_qspi_combined_seq_xfer(struct tegra_qspi *tqspi,
 					QSPI_DMA_TIMEOUT);
 
 			if (WARN_ON_ONCE(ret == 0)) {
-				dev_err(tqspi->dev, "QSPI Transfer failed with timeout: %d\n",
-					ret);
+				dev_err_ratelimited(tqspi->dev,
+						    "QSPI Transfer failed with timeout\n");
 				if (tqspi->is_curr_dma_xfer &&
 				    (tqspi->cur_direction & DATA_DIR_TX))
 					dmaengine_terminate_all
